Proposals are now being accepted for the "Chick Lit." Area, and all those
interested are encouraged to participate. (Graduate students/future teachers
are particularly welcome to participate or register to attend the
conference.) Listed below are some suggestions for possible presentations,
but topics not included here are also welcome.

. Confessional narrative/style
. "Chick lit." novel to film adaptations
. Diversity of "chick lit." (British, American, Latina, African-American,
etc.)
. Sub-genres (e.g., "Chica lit.")
. Rhetorical and genre-related issues (Can men write "chick lit.?" Can men
author "chick lit.?")
. Status/reputation (Do "chick lit." authors merit greater respect?)
. And much more . . .
